Stratulat Albulescu has advised QeOPS and its shareholders on a partial exit to Cargus, owned by Mid Europa Partners.

QeOPS is a Romanian company specialized in logistics for online commerce, owned and run by Paul and Gabriel Copil.  

Cargus is a courier, express, and parcel service provider in Romania, offering last mile delivery to over 85,000 customers, including business clients, e-commerce retailers, and private individuals. 

According to the firm, “the acquisition will strengthen Cargus' value-added service offering for its customers, in line with the company's strategic investments over the past two years, focusing mostly on digitization and improvement of the overall customer experience.”

Stratulat Albulescu’s team was led by Partner Cristina Man with the support of Senior Associate Adrian Hlistei-Muresan.

Stratulat Albulescu could not provide additional information on the matter.

Editor's note: After this article was published, Bondoc & Asociatii informed CEE Legal Matters it had advised Cargus on the acquisition of a majority stake in QeOPS. The firm's team was led by Partner Cosmin Stavaru and included Partner Lucian Bondoc and Counsel Daniela Gladunea.
